Hardin County Chamber of Commerce would like to congratulate Matthew Rivera on being chosen as the ABC Student of the Month. Matthew is a Fort Knox High School senior and the son of retired Sgt. Maj. Vickie Rivera and Sgt. 1st Class Ted Rivera. Matthew is his class salutatorian, a basketball team captain, president of the National Honor Society and Fort Knox JROTC Battalion Commander. In addition, he also is a member of the Fort Knox Y-Club, student council, Order of the Eagle Claw, color guard and Raider Team. As a leader in the community, Matthew has tutored high school students, organized and executed clothing and food drives, served in soup kitchens, and has worked with numerous projects relating to the well-being of soldiers on Fort Knox.
Because of Matthew’s hard work and dedication, he has received many awards and honors such as the President’s Education Award, Presidential Fitness Award, Principal’s Award, 4.0 GPA Award, Superior JROTC Cadet Medal, Student of the Quarter, and has been placed on the 5th Region Basketball All-A Academic Team twice.
In December 2016, Matthew received a Congressional Nomination from Congressman Brett Guthrie to the United States Military Academy at West Point. In January 2017, Matthew formally received an appointment to the United States Military Academy at West Point and will report on July 3 with a major in law.
ABC Students of the Month are awarded a plaque and $50 gift certificate, provide by the Chamber.
